Lovleena MishraMom of 2 children4 years agoA. You can get the mRNA Covid 19 vaccine as it is safe for breastfeeding mothers. This vaccine does not contain live virus so it won't give you or your baby Covid 19. The components of the vaccine are not known to harm the breastfed babies. When the vaccine is administered, the small particles of the mRNA vaccine are used up the muscle cells at the injection site and are less likely to reach breast milk. If any small particle does reach, it will be digested. When you get vaccinated, your immune system will produce antibodies that fight Covid 19. These antibodies can pass to your baby through breast milk and can protect your baby from Covid 19.
